Clemson University and Gamify collaborated to introduce the first full-length, web-based bully-prevention interactive role-playing game — Yozgoo.
Yozgoo is based on world-renowned, peer-reviewed scholarly research on comprehensive bullying prevention. Students build a character and play to learn how to identify bullying, manage bullying behavior, and apply best practices in real bullying situations.
The student is immersed in a story-driven, fictitious world designed to simulate the bullying problems students face every day — stylized in a safe, kid-friendly theme from the first scene to the last.
